アクチエータ23で構成されている。EXAMPLE Hereinafter, an example of the present invention will be described based on FIGS. 1 to 6. Reference numeral 5 denotes a stock section, which winds up and stores tubular parts. The roller 6 rises as the tubular part is fed, and when it reaches a fixed position, the stock part 5 rotates and descends. This places a constant tension on the tubular component. 7 is a feeding section, a fixed chuck 8,
In the cylinder 9, the feeding direction of the tubular part (arrow X direction)
It consists of a sliding chuck 1o that slides on the chuck 1o. Reference numeral 11 is a head, which has a tapered tip and has a groove formed at the cutting position, and a pin 12 that serves as a core bar during cutting and also holds the inner circumference of the tubular part in a regular manner after cutting, and a pin 12 that is fed by a feeding section 7. pin 12
The stripper 14 serves as a stopper for the tip of the tubular component inserted into the stripper 14, and also serves to push the tubular component by sliding in the direction of arrow V in the cylinder 13 during insertion. Reference numeral 15 denotes a cutting section, which includes a cutting blade 16 for cutting the tubular part, and a cutting blade 16 that slides oppositely to cut the tubular part.
It consists of a guide 17, two cylinders 18, and a gear 2o to which these are attached and which is rotated by the rotation of a motor 19 to rotate the tubular part. Reference numeral 21 denotes a transfer section, which includes a slider 22 that slides the head in the direction of arrow Z, and an actuator 23 that rotates this slider 22 in the direction of arrow Y.

すると、管状部品を全周に渡って切断することになる。Next, the operation will be explained. Sliding chuck 1 of feeding section 7
o holds the tubular part and slides it in the direction of arrow X, the tubular part is sent and its tip reaches the stripper 14 with the head
(See Figure 3). At this time, the fixed chuck 8 holds the tubular part, and then the cutting blade 1e slides due to the movement of the cylinder 18, and then when the gear 2o rotates due to the rotation of the motor 19, the tubular part is cut all around. It turns out.

きによって、ヘッド11は下降し、挿入位置上に来る。The cutting dimension will be the diameter (see Figure 6). Next, the head 11 leaves the cutting section 15 by sliding the slider 22. At this time, the cut tubular part is held around the pin 12 of the head. Next, after the actuator 23 rotates and the head 11 faces downward, the head 11 is lowered again by the movement of the slider 22 and comes to the insertion position.

なる。The stripper 14 will then slide in the V direction and the tubular part will be pushed into the insertion position. After insertion, head 1
1 returns to the position of the cutting part 7. At this time, pin 12 is
It will be thrust into the tip of the tubular part. By repeating these operations, the tubular parts are continuously cut and inserted.
